I would call this video a parable. A parable is a story that creates an image in our mind, using something that is familiar (or “normal”) and then turns that image in a way that has us re-think what should be “normal”. You can check your bible for any number of examples of parable by Jesus (i.e. The Good Samaritan – Luke 10:25-37).
